How Anonib Works

So, how does Anonib work its magic? Simply put, Anonib is a web browser that offers a range of features designed to enhance user anonymity online. When you use Anonib, your internet traffic is routed through a global network of servers, making it incredibly difficult to track your online activities. Additionally, Anonib employs advanced encryption protocols to protect your personal data from any prying eyes. This results in a browsing experience that's both fast and secure.

Opportunities and Realistic Risks

While Anonib offers a range of opportunities for users seeking enhanced online security, there are also some potential risks to consider. For example, using Anonib may result in slower browsing speeds due to the added encryption and IP masking. Additionally, Anonib's servers may be subject to government requests, which could potentially compromise user anonymity.

Common Misconceptions

Several misconceptions surround Anonib, with some users assuming it's an ideal tool for illegal activities or hacking. However, Anonib is simply a browser designed to enhance online security and anonymity. Using Anonib does not grant users immunity from the law or exempt them from potential consequences.

Who is Anonib Relevant For

Anonib is relevant for anyone seeking to enhance their online security and anonymity. This includes individuals working remotely, journalists, and anyone concerned about data collection and sharing by third-party services.
